Understanding Cloud-Based Mobile App Testing Services
Cloud-based testing utilizes cloud infrastructure to replicate real-world scenarios across different devices and platforms. This approach enables testing teams to validate app functionality, performance, and compatibility without the need for physical devices. By leveraging cloud environments, testers can remotely access a wide array of real devices, thereby optimizing the testing workflow and expanding device coverage.
Effective Approaches to Cloud-Based Testing
- Achieving Maximum Device Coverage: Instead of being limited by a local set of devices, cloud-based testing platforms provide access to a wide variety of physical devices. This allows testers to evaluate application performance across different operating system versions, device types, screen sizes, and network conditions.
- Integrating Automated Testing: Automation tools like Appium, Selenium, and XCUITest are easily incorporated into cloud-based testing environments. This integration supports continuous and automated testing across multiple devices, which speeds up feedback loops and reduces the time it takes to fix bugs.
- Implementing Parallel Testing: Cloud-based testing infrastructures allow tests to be run simultaneously on multiple devices. This significantly reduces the total time required to assess application performance across a range of different environments.
- Ensuring Scalability: Cloud-based testing provides the ability to scale resources as needed. This allows testing teams to efficiently adjust their testing environment based on the complexity of the application being tested, removing hardware limitations and ensuring testing efficiency.
- Simulating Geolocation Scenarios: Cloud-based testing makes it possible to simulate different geographical locations. This ensures that mobile applications deliver a consistent and optimal user experience for users in various parts of the world.

Developing Your Testing Framework
Initiating cloud testing involves the creation of a detailed test strategy. This overarching document, informed by the business requirements document, defines the standards for software testing. Typically, a business analyst or project manager develops the test strategy, which sets out the long-term goals. The test plan, which is informed by the Software Requirements Specification (SRS), specifies the detailed processes and requirements.
Essential elements of a test strategy include:
- Goals and breadth
- Testing methodologies and documentation standards
- Team communication structures
- Stakeholder communication protocols
Conversely, test plans pinpoint the test plan identifier, the precise features under test, related activities, expected outputs, assigned roles, and project schedules.

Embracing Test Automation in Cloud-Based Testing
Automating repetitive tests enhances testing efficiency, saves development cycles, and improves software quality, especially when performed within a cloud-based testing environment. Quality assurance teams can maximize their limited resources by implementing automated testing tools for comprehensive and data-intensive tests in the cloud. While manual testing is preferable for infrequent tests, automated testing is ideal for cases requiring frequent execution within a cloud-based setup.
Navigating Challenges in Mobile Testing with Cloud-Based Solutions
Fragmentation poses a significant challenge, necessitating extensive testing across various devices, operating systems, and browsers. Cloud-based testing addresses this by providing access to a wide range of configurations, ensuring compatibility without the need for a physical device lab. While establishing a physical hub of popular devices can be one solution, it is often costly and less scalable compared to cloud-based testing.
Additionally, new technologies introduced during the app lifecycle may require ongoing adjustments to ensure compatibility. Developers must also prioritize security, as apps with weak encryption are vulnerable to breaches. Rigorous testing, facilitated by cloud-based testing environments, is essential to protect user data and maintain robust security protocols.

Cloud Testing vs. On-Premises Testing
Cloud-based testing offers substantial advantages over traditional on-premises testing, including flexible pricing models and accelerated time to market. While the fundamental functional testing processes remain consistent between cloud-based and on-premises applications, it is crucial to address the unique non-functional risks inherent in cloud environments.
When cloud-based testing involves production data, ensuring robust security measures and validating data integrity protocols are paramount before initiating functional testing. Furthermore, cloud-based testing facilitates access from any location or device with internet connectivity, a stark contrast to on-premises testing, which necessitates a physical, on-site presence.
